American Horse Council - www.horsecouncil.org

Founded in 1969, the AHC was organized by a group of horsemen concerned about federal legislation affecting their industry. They recognized the need for national and coordinated industry action in Washington, DC. The AHC promotes and protects all horse breeds, disciplines and interests by communicating with Congress, federal agencies, the media and the horse industry itself each and every day.

American Horse Defense Fund, Inc. - www.ahdf.org

The American Horse Defense Fund's (AHDF) was founded in 2000. AHDF’s mission is to facilitate the protection, conservation, and humane treatment of members of all equine species. AHDF works to address inhumane treatment of horses, ponies, donkeys, mules and burros, both wild and domesticated through education, advocacy and litigation when necessary in the state, federal and international arenas.

American Horse Publications - www.americanhorsepubs.org

American Horse Publications (AHP) is a non-profit association established in 1970 to promote better understanding and communications within the equine publishing industry. Over 470 members include equine-related publications, professionals, students, organizations and businesses.

American Society of Equine Appraisers - www.equineappraiser.com

Founded in 1985, the ASEA is the nation's only appraisal association exclusively for horse appraisers.

Oregon Horseman's Association - www.oregonhorsemen.com

Encouraging sportsmanship between exhibitors and spectators alike since 1954, promoting and sponsoring equine activities as a means of instilling a sense of achievement and values in youth and the enjoyment of members and ensure safe and humane treatment of equines at OHA approved functions.

Through continuous training and licensing of recognized judges and stewards, OHA strives to create professionals to preside at all OHA activities without creating an unduly restrictive atmosphere, while maintaining an involvement with the Oregon Legislature and other appropriate government agencies connected with laws, rules, and regulations which impact on the equine world, keeping their members informed of any potential changes or problems in the laws that might impact the equine industry.

Oregon Thoroughbred Owner's & Breeder's Association - www.oregontoba.com

The Oregon Thoroughbred Owners & Breeders Association (Oregon TOBA) is a non-profit corporation committed to serving the interests of Oregon's breeding and racing industries. Their mission is to increase public interest through promotion and advancement of the breeding and racing of Oregon Thoroughbreds. Their goal is to strengthen the Oregon Thoroughbred industry, in cooperation with the board of directors and members, both in breeding and racing with new innovative ideas and incentive programs for the betterment of the horse racing industry.
